After some hours of fiddling with ndiswrapper I have successfully managed to connect to my wireless network with my network card which sports a Realtek RTL8190 chipset. I'm using Ubuntu 14.04 and the Win XP 64bit driver which came with the network card. However when trying to disconnect from the wifi network or shutting down the system, the system gets locked by ndiswrapper.
